みんなの「教えて(疑問・質問)」にみんなで「答える」Q&Aコミュニティ

こんにちはゲストさん。会員登録(無料)して質問・回答してみよう!

解決済みの質問

C#でstop()が使えない。

http://kana-soft.com/tech/sample_0012_3.htm#WebBrowser_Stop

このHPを参考にstop()メソッドを使おうとしたのですがSTOP()に下記のエラーが出ます。


'System.Windows.Forms.WebBrowser' に 'stop' の定義が含まれておらず、型'System.Windows.Forms.WebBrowser' の最初の引数を受け付ける拡張メソッドが見つかりませんでした。using ディレクティブまたはアセンブリ参照が不足しています。



VS2010を使用し、.NETは4なので問題なく使えると思うのですが原因不明です。

以下ソースです。



using System;
using System.Collections.Generic;
using System.ComponentModel;
using System.Data;
using System.Drawing;
using System.Linq;
using System.Text;
using System.Windows.Forms;

namespace busywait4
{
public partial class Form1 : Form
{
public Form1()
{
InitializeComponent();
}

private void button1_Click(object sender, EventArgs e)
{
webBrowser1.Navigate("http://yahoo.co.jp");//もう一度、アクセスしなおす。
}

int i;
private void webBrowser1_DocumentCompleted(object sender, WebBrowserDocumentCompletedEventArgs e)
{
webBrowser1.stop();
}

投稿日時 - 2014-05-08 08:08:12

QNo.8585789

すぐに回答ほしいです

質問者が選んだベストアンサー

× webBrowser1.stop();
○ webBrowser1.Stop();

C#は大文字・小文字を区別しますのでご注意を。

http://msdn.microsoft.com/ja-jp/library/system.windows.forms.webbrowser.stop%28v=vs.110%29.aspx

投稿日時 - 2014-05-08 08:43:53

お礼

誠に失礼しました。

投稿日時 - 2014-05-08 22:23:03

このQ&Aは役に立ちましたか?

6人が「このQ&Aが役に立った」と投票しています

回答(2)

ANo.2

Wr5

>webBrowser1.stop();

本当に「stop()」なんですか?

http://msdn.microsoft.com/ja-jp/library/system.windows.forms.webbrowser.stop%28v=vs.100%29.aspx
「Stop()」ではなく?

メソッドの大文字小文字は区別されるハズですけど。
故に、エラーメッセージが
> 'stop' の定義が含まれておらず
なんじゃないですかね?

投稿日時 - 2014-05-08 08:45:05

お礼

誠に失礼しました。

投稿日時 - 2014-05-08 22:23:08

あなたにオススメの質問